AppendChild(XMLElement element, bool asCopy=false) | Urho3D::XMLElement | |
CreateChild(const String &name) | Urho3D::XMLElement | |
CreateChild(const char *name) | Urho3D::XMLElement | |
EMPTY | Urho3D::XMLElement | static |
file_ | Urho3D::XMLElement | private |
GetAttribute(const String &name=String::EMPTY) const | Urho3D::XMLElement | |
GetAttribute(const char *name) const | Urho3D::XMLElement | |
GetAttributeCString(const char *name) const | Urho3D::XMLElement | |
GetAttributeLower(const String &name) const | Urho3D::XMLElement | |
GetAttributeLower(const char *name) const | Urho3D::XMLElement | |
GetAttributeNames() const | Urho3D::XMLElement | |
GetAttributeUpper(const String &name) const | Urho3D::XMLElement | |
GetAttributeUpper(const char *name) const | Urho3D::XMLElement | |
GetBool(const String &name) const | Urho3D::XMLElement | |
GetBoundingBox() const | Urho3D::XMLElement | |
GetBuffer(const String &name) const | Urho3D::XMLElement | |
GetBuffer(const String &name, void *dest, i32 size) const | Urho3D::XMLElement | |
GetChild(const String &name=String::EMPTY) const | Urho3D::XMLElement | |
GetChild(const char *name) const | Urho3D::XMLElement | |
GetColor(const String &name) const | Urho3D::XMLElement | |
GetDouble(const String &name) const | Urho3D::XMLElement | |
GetFile() const | Urho3D::XMLElement | |
GetFloat(const String &name) const | Urho3D::XMLElement | |
GetI32(const String &name) const | Urho3D::XMLElement | |
GetI64(const String &name) const | Urho3D::XMLElement | |
GetIntRect(const String &name) const | Urho3D::XMLElement | |
GetIntVector2(const String &name) const | Urho3D::XMLElement | |
GetIntVector3(const String &name) const | Urho3D::XMLElement | |
GetMatrix3(const String &name) const | Urho3D::XMLElement | |
GetMatrix3x4(const String &name) const | Urho3D::XMLElement | |
GetMatrix4(const String &name) const | Urho3D::XMLElement | |
GetName() const | Urho3D::XMLElement | |
GetNext(const String &name=String::EMPTY) const | Urho3D::XMLElement | |
GetNext(const char *name) const | Urho3D::XMLElement | |
GetNode() const | Urho3D::XMLElement | inline |
GetNumAttributes() const | Urho3D::XMLElement | |
GetOrCreateChild(const String &name) | Urho3D::XMLElement | |
GetOrCreateChild(const char *name) | Urho3D::XMLElement | |
GetParent() const | Urho3D::XMLElement | |
GetQuaternion(const String &name) const | Urho3D::XMLElement | |
GetRect(const String &name) const | Urho3D::XMLElement | |
GetResourceRef() const | Urho3D::XMLElement | |
GetResourceRefList() const | Urho3D::XMLElement | |
GetStringVector() const | Urho3D::XMLElement | |
GetU32(const String &name) const | Urho3D::XMLElement | |
GetU64(const String &name) const | Urho3D::XMLElement | |
GetValue() const | Urho3D::XMLElement | |
GetVariant() const | Urho3D::XMLElement | |
GetVariantMap() const | Urho3D::XMLElement | |
GetVariantValue(VariantType type) const | Urho3D::XMLElement | |
GetVariantVector() const | Urho3D::XMLElement | |
GetVector(const String &name) const | Urho3D::XMLElement | |
GetVector2(const String &name) const | Urho3D::XMLElement | |
GetVector3(const String &name) const | Urho3D::XMLElement | |
GetVector4(const String &name) const | Urho3D::XMLElement | |
GetVectorVariant(const String &name) const | Urho3D::XMLElement | |
GetXPathNode() const | Urho3D::XMLElement | inline |
GetXPathResultIndex() const | Urho3D::XMLElement | inline |
GetXPathResultSet() const | Urho3D::XMLElement | inline |
HasAttribute(const String &name) const | Urho3D::XMLElement | |
HasAttribute(const char *name) const | Urho3D::XMLElement | |
HasChild(const String &name) const | Urho3D::XMLElement | |
HasChild(const char *name) const | Urho3D::XMLElement | |
IsNull() const | Urho3D::XMLElement | |
NextResult() const | Urho3D::XMLElement | |
node_ | Urho3D::XMLElement | private |
NotNull() const | Urho3D::XMLElement | |
operator bool() const | Urho3D::XMLElement | explicit |
operator=(const XMLElement &rhs) | Urho3D::XMLElement | |
Remove() | Urho3D::XMLElement | |
RemoveAttribute(const String &name=String::EMPTY) | Urho3D::XMLElement | |
RemoveAttribute(const char *name) | Urho3D::XMLElement | |
RemoveChild(const XMLElement &element) | Urho3D::XMLElement | |
RemoveChild(const String &name) | Urho3D::XMLElement | |
RemoveChild(const char *name) | Urho3D::XMLElement | |
RemoveChildren(const String &name=String::EMPTY) | Urho3D::XMLElement | |
RemoveChildren(const char *name) | Urho3D::XMLElement | |
Select(const String &query, pugi::xpath_variable_set *variables=nullptr) const | Urho3D::XMLElement | |
SelectPrepared(const XPathQuery &query) const | Urho3D::XMLElement | |
SelectSingle(const String &query, pugi::xpath_variable_set *variables=nullptr) const | Urho3D::XMLElement | |
SelectSinglePrepared(const XPathQuery &query) const | Urho3D::XMLElement | |
SetAttribute(const String &name, const String &value) | Urho3D::XMLElement | |
SetAttribute(const char *name, const char *value) | Urho3D::XMLElement | |
SetAttribute(const String &value) | Urho3D::XMLElement | |
SetAttribute(const char *value) | Urho3D::XMLElement | |
SetBool(const String &name, bool value) | Urho3D::XMLElement | |
SetBoundingBox(const BoundingBox &value) | Urho3D::XMLElement | |
SetBuffer(const String &name, const void *data, i32 size) | Urho3D::XMLElement | |
SetBuffer(const String &name, const Vector< unsigned char > &value) | Urho3D::XMLElement | |
SetColor(const String &name, const Color &value) | Urho3D::XMLElement | |
SetDouble(const String &name, double value) | Urho3D::XMLElement | |
SetFloat(const String &name, float value) | Urho3D::XMLElement | |
SetI32(const String &name, i32 value) | Urho3D::XMLElement | |
SetI64(const String &name, i64 value) | Urho3D::XMLElement | |
SetIntRect(const String &name, const IntRect &value) | Urho3D::XMLElement | |
SetIntVector2(const String &name, const IntVector2 &value) | Urho3D::XMLElement | |
SetIntVector3(const String &name, const IntVector3 &value) | Urho3D::XMLElement | |
SetMatrix3(const String &name, const Matrix3 &value) | Urho3D::XMLElement | |
SetMatrix3x4(const String &name, const Matrix3x4 &value) | Urho3D::XMLElement | |
SetMatrix4(const String &name, const Matrix4 &value) | Urho3D::XMLElement | |
SetQuaternion(const String &name, const Quaternion &value) | Urho3D::XMLElement | |
SetRect(const String &name, const Rect &value) | Urho3D::XMLElement | |
SetResourceRef(const ResourceRef &value) | Urho3D::XMLElement | |
SetResourceRefList(const ResourceRefList &value) | Urho3D::XMLElement | |
SetString(const String &name, const String &value) | Urho3D::XMLElement | |
SetStringVector(const StringVector &value) | Urho3D::XMLElement | |
SetU32(const String &name, u32 value) | Urho3D::XMLElement | |
SetU64(const String &name, u64 value) | Urho3D::XMLElement | |
SetValue(const String &value) | Urho3D::XMLElement | |
SetValue(const char *value) | Urho3D::XMLElement | |
SetVariant(const Variant &value) | Urho3D::XMLElement | |
SetVariantMap(const VariantMap &value) | Urho3D::XMLElement | |
SetVariantValue(const Variant &value) | Urho3D::XMLElement | |
SetVariantVector(const VariantVector &value) | Urho3D::XMLElement | |
SetVector2(const String &name, const Vector2 &value) | Urho3D::XMLElement | |
SetVector3(const String &name, const Vector3 &value) | Urho3D::XMLElement | |
SetVector4(const String &name, const Vector4 &value) | Urho3D::XMLElement | |
SetVectorVariant(const String &name, const Variant &value) | Urho3D::XMLElement | |
XMLElement() | Urho3D::XMLElement | |
XMLElement(XMLFile *file, pugi::xml_node_struct *node) | Urho3D::XMLElement | |
XMLElement(XMLFile *file, const XPathResultSet *resultSet, const pugi::xpath_node *xpathNode, i32 xpathResultIndex) | Urho3D::XMLElement | |
XMLElement(const XMLElement &rhs) | Urho3D::XMLElement | |
xpathNode_ | Urho3D::XMLElement | private |
xpathResultIndex_ | Urho3D::XMLElement | mutableprivate |
xpathResultSet_ | Urho3D::XMLElement | private |
~XMLElement() | Urho3D::XMLElement | |